Bitcoin: Beginning of a New Era

Bitcoin was conceived of an anonymous entity known as Nakamoto Satoshi and was introduced in 2009. It is a peer-to-peer digital money system that cuts out the need for traditional middlemen like banks. Instead, transactions are made directly between users, with the decentralized network verifying the transactions.

The inner workings of Bitcoin: A Primer

Bitcoin operates on a technology termed as blockchain technology. It's a public ledger which contains all transaction data from anyone who uses bitcoin. Transactions are gathered into blocks before being included into the blockchain. Miners validate these transactions in a process that involves sophisticated computers and software, solving highly complex mathematical problems.

Risks Associated with Bitcoin

While Bitcoin presents several distinctive attributes, it also comes with certain risks. Its value is highly volatile and can fluctuate significantly, which can result in dramatic losses for those who invest in it. Additionally, while the blockchain is secure, Bitcoin wallets—where users keep their Bitcoin—can be subject to hackers.
